How can I definitively distinguish a true fractional CO₂ laser from a non-fractional or ablative-only device marketed as fractional for skin resurfacing?

Many manufacturers use the term “fractional” loosely. A true fractional CO₂ laser operates by delivering laser energy in a micro-ablative pattern, creating thousands of microscopic treatment zones (MTZs) while leaving surrounding tissue intact. This selective photothermolysis stimulates neocollagenesis and re-epithelialization with minimal downtime. To definitively distinguish, look for specifications detailing the spot size (typically 100-300 microns), the density of MTZs per square centimeter (often adjustable from 5% to 80% coverage), and the presence of a scanning handpiece with customizable patterns (e.g., squares, circles, lines). Non-fractional or ablative-only devices will typically deliver a uniform, full-field ablation, leading to significantly longer recovery times and higher risks. Requesting clinical data demonstrating fractional healing patterns (e.g., histology showing columns of ablated tissue surrounded by healthy skin) is also a strong indicator. Be wary of machines that only offer a single, large spot size or claim fractional results without adjustable density and pattern options for skin rejuvenation.

Beyond price, what specific technical specifications should I scrutinize to understand the actual power output and treatment efficacy of a CO₂ fractional laser, especially for deep acne scars or severe photoaging?

While peak power (watts) is often highlighted, it's crucial to understand energy delivery for effective skin resurfacing. Focus on pulse energy (millijoules per pulse) and pulse duration (microseconds or milliseconds). For deep acne scars or severe photoaging, you need sufficient energy to reach the reticular dermis and induce significant collagen remodeling. A higher pulse energy allows for deeper penetration with fewer passes, while a shorter pulse duration (e.g., ultra-pulse mode) can achieve more precise ablation with less thermal damage to surrounding tissue, minimizing post-inflammatory hyperpigmentation (PIH). Also, investigate the beam quality and spot uniformity. A top-hat beam profile ensures consistent energy delivery across the treatment area, preventing hot spots or areas of insufficient treatment. Ask for specifications on the scanner's speed and precision, as this directly impacts the consistency of MTZ creation. A robust CO₂ laser system will provide detailed parameters for various indications.

When evaluating a CO₂ fractional laser, what are the often-overlooked maintenance requirements and consumable costs that significantly impact the long-term operational budget, especially for a new clinic?

Beyond the initial purchase price, the long-term operational costs of a CO₂ fractional laser can be substantial. Often overlooked are the lifespan and replacement cost of the CO₂ laser tube itself (typically 10,000-20,000 hours, but varies), which can be a significant expense. The cost of disposable tips or handpiece covers, which are crucial for hygiene and consistent beam delivery, can accumulate rapidly. Regular calibration and preventative maintenance by certified technicians are essential to ensure optimal performance and patient safety; inquire about service contract options and their associated costs. Furthermore, consider the cost of the smoke evacuator filters, which are mandatory for safe operation and require periodic replacement. Factor in the cost of distilled water for the cooling system and any proprietary software updates. A comprehensive understanding of these beauty machine consumables and service needs is vital for accurate budgeting.

How can I spot counterfeit CO₂ fractional laser machines that mimic legitimate brands, particularly when purchasing from international suppliers or online marketplaces?

The proliferation of counterfeit CO₂ fractional laser machines is a serious concern. Beyond suspiciously low prices, look for inconsistencies in branding, logos, and serial numbers. Genuine manufacturers often have specific holographic seals, unique serial number formats, and detailed user manuals in multiple languages. Request proof of international certifications (e.g., CE, FDA, ISO 13485) and verify them directly with the issuing body, not just relying on provided certificates. Counterfeit devices often use inferior components, leading to unreliable performance, safety hazards (e.g., unstable energy output, poor cooling), and a lack of clinical efficacy. Insist on a factory tour or video inspection if purchasing from an unfamiliar supplier. Check for a traceable supply chain and verify the manufacturer's official website and contact information. A reputable laser manufacturer will readily provide all necessary documentation and support.

What are the critical software and user interface features that differentiate a user-friendly and clinically versatile CO₂ fractional laser from a basic, limited model, especially for practitioners with varying experience levels?

A well-designed software interface is paramount for both safety and efficacy. Look for intuitive navigation with pre-set treatment protocols for various indications (e.g., acne scar treatment, wrinkle reduction, pigment removal), which can be customized and saved. Advanced models often feature a touch-screen interface with clear graphical representations of treatment patterns, density, and energy settings. Critical features include real-time feedback on energy delivery, an integrated patient management system, and customizable pulse modes (e.g., continuous, pulsed, ultra-pulse, fractional). For versatility, ensure the software allows for independent adjustment of spot size, pulse energy, and pulse duration, rather than just pre-set combinations. A robust system should also offer safety interlocks and error messages for incorrect parameter settings. The ability to easily upgrade software for future enhancements is also a significant advantage for a medical aesthetic device.

How does the choice of CO₂ fractional laser technology (e.g., sealed-off tube vs. flowing gas tube, RF excited vs. DC excited) directly impact the longevity, consistency of energy output, and overall cost of ownership for a busy aesthetic practice?

The type of CO₂ laser tube significantly influences performance and cost. Sealed-off CO₂ tubes (often RF-excited) are more common in modern aesthetic devices. They are compact, require less maintenance, and offer excellent beam quality and stability. RF excitation provides very precise pulse control, leading to consistent energy delivery and reduced thermal damage. Their lifespan is typically 10,000-20,000 hours, after which the tube needs replacement. Flowing gas CO₂ tubes (often DC-excited) are generally larger, require a continuous supply of gas, and have higher maintenance demands, though they can offer very high power output. While initially less expensive, their operational costs can be higher due to gas consumption and more frequent servicing. For a busy aesthetic practice, the consistency of energy output from an RF-excited, sealed-off tube is often preferred for predictable clinical outcomes and lower long-term maintenance hassle, making it a superior choice for a reliable CO₂ laser system.
